Endurance Engineer David Laino shares his experience installing a Wind Turbine in Wisconsin...
The David Jolly installation went well, with just one minor hiccup and all in all it was a smooth operation.
David and Deb Jolly were superior hosts. They treated me as an old friend, providing excellent accommodations and food. The property is fantastic, right off the highway exit, very rural, in a beautiful landscape with ponds and fields and a red barn too. David may decide to install another turbine soon.
The work days were long, but Dave and his friend Bob were tireless workers. Tower work is by far the larger assembly project. Efforts to measure the guy wires to reduce adjustments seemed to help. Once the tower was finished, turbine assembly was a snap, less than four hours total. I even managed to get the new isolation washers and bushings on in record time putting them on the studs prior to mounting the turbine. This is my new recommended technique, and we may even wish to ship new turbines with a set of washers and the bushings on the studs already. The Endurance Wind Turbine is now in service.
